Stockport-based travel agency says deal will help it to respond to new market demands

UK travel agency Royal Travel has completed a deal to use the Sabre GDS travel agent platform.

The family-run 30-year-old Stockport-based firm will also use Sabre Virtual Payments (SVP), a flexible electronic payment solution.

SVP provides multi-bank, multi-card, credit and prepaid accounts, which allow customers to select the best payment option and the most favourable payment terms.

The multi-year deal will see Royal Travel access travel content within the Sabre GDS to shop, book and manage travel for customers.

The firm will use the Sabre Red 360 travel agent platform which Sabre said will “allow it to harness more data, content and flexibility”.

The GDS added this will enable the agency to differentiate its offering, manage its operations and workflow more effectively and to offer clients a more personalized experience.
